Export Site List to CSV
Whether you’re tracking site activity, checking subscription info, or just like having things neat and organised, exporting your site list is quick and easy.
🗂️ How to Export Your Site List
Need a copy of your site list? Don’t stress! You can export up to 20,000 of your most recent sites from your dashboard into a neat little CSV file. This is great if you want to see all the details in one place, sort them, or keep a record.
🧾 What You'll Get in the File:
The exported file will include info like:
- Site name
- Site alias (nickname)
- External UID (don’t worry if this means nothing to you)
- Site URL (if it’s published)
- Status (published or unpublished)
- When the site was created
- First publish date (if it was ever published)
- Last time it was published
- Auto-renew setting (on/off/null)
- Next renewal date (if any)
- Any labels you’ve added
- Subscription type
- Failed billing (TRUE if a payment failed)
📤 How to Export the Site List:
- Go to your dashboard (where you see all your sites).
- Look for the three little grey dots next to the “Create New Site” button.
- Click those dots and choose “Export CSV.”
- You’ll see a message saying it worked — and the file will be sent to your account email.
- The file will come in a .zip format, so you’ll just need to unzip it to open the CSV.
